Broken Hill, NSW

We had to go to central Australia, where the Feral goats are rounded up and sent to the Depots for distribution.

The ferral goat is an introduced species to Australia, and has been left to run wild in the desert, It is estimated there is over 30 million wild goats, and 20 million wild camels in central australia, that is destroying the fragil land.

so these animals are rounded up.

I am told, the way the roud the goats up, is by placing salt blocks near water holes. They place large netting like a fence around these waterholes, with a one way gate.

So the goats who love the salt then go to the waterholes for the water, and go through the one way gates.

It is Outback Australia, and it really is the RED CENTRE.

the colour of the soil, and rocks, are just an irredescent red ocre in colour so bright.

There had been a flood six weeks earlier, that has taken weeks to clear up.

it was the worst flood in 30 years, and that is why the desert has a greenish tinge, as now this is the best season for feed in over 30 years.

The deport is 110 kms in land from Broken Hill.

Broken Hill, not far from the South Australian Border is a mining town, they mine, Tin, Silver, and many other minerals.

A beautiful of authentic Australian Outback town, beautiful architecture unique to the ton of the original buildings built around 1881, with huge wide verandahs.
